JOB SUMMARY

Performs complex accounting duties, prepares financial and statistical reports, delivers training to others, develops and/or manages complex budgets, and develops and documents controls for accounting systems to ensure the accurate recording and reporting of the business unit's financial transaction, assists with optimization of the Workday Finance system, including Financial Data Model (FDM) configuration, and supports intercompany accounting and consolidation processes. May lead and be a resource for others in their department/unit.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
  • Bachelor's degree required, Master's preferred
  • 4-6 years of relevant experience required
  • Experience with Workday Finance required; familiarity with FDM configuration and maintenance preferred
  • Experience with intercompany accounting and financial consolidation processes preferred


KEY RESPONSIBILITIES & ACCOUNTABILITIES
  • Leads and executes the development, organization, preparation, and updating of complex financial statements, journals, accounts, ledgers, and reports for various financial needs within an automated financial system to ensure accurate recording and reporting of financial transactions
  • Manages and maintains the Financial Data Model (FDM), including updating, and governance of worktags, cost centers, and organizational hierarchies to ensure data accuracy and reporting consistency
  • Supports maintenance of Workday Finance, including testing configurations, troubleshooting, and ongoing optimization to support financial operations
  • Performs intercompany accounting transactions, ensuring proper elimination entries, reconciliation of intercompany balances, and compliance with internal policies
  • Supports and executes financial consolidation processes, including the aggregation of entity-level financials, preparation of consolidated reporting packages, and provides international audit support
  • Prepares and analyzes financial reports, data and records, identifies discrepancies, investigates, and recommends solutions as needed
  • Monitors automated financial systems, develops, and documents controls to ensure system reliability and data integrity
  • Performs complex accounting and auditing reconciliations, journal entries, schedules, and reports
  • Answers questions and provides accounting related information to internal and external stakeholders according to established policies and procedures
  • Facilitates trainings and provides financial guidance to management and staff on accounting processes, Workday Finance functionality, and FDM structure
